NFL Star Jordan Shipley Hospitalized with Severe Burns After Ranch Accident - Full Story (2026)

In a shocking turn of events, former Texas football star and NFL wide receiver Jordan Shipley has been hospitalized after suffering serious burns from a troubling accident on his ranch. This incident occurred on Tuesday, and it has left many fans and sports enthusiasts anxious about his condition.

Family members have shared that the Longhorns icon is currently in a 'critical but stable condition' following this unfortunate incident in Burnet, Texas. A statement released by his family, as reported by On3, detailed the harrowing circumstances: "Jordan was involved in an accident this afternoon near his hometown of Burnet. The machine he was operating on his ranch caught fire, and while he managed to escape, he sustained severe burns during the ordeal. He was able to reach one of his ranch workers, who promptly drove him to a nearby hospital. From there, he was flown via air ambulance to Austin, where he continues to fight for recovery."

At 40 years old, Shipley had a brief but noteworthy career in the NFL, playing for several teams including the Cincinnati Bengals, Jacksonville Jaguars, and Tampa Bay Buccaneers. Drafted in 2010 as the 84th overall pick, he signed a four-year contract valued at $2.45 million, which included a signing bonus of $757,000.

Shipley's entry into the league was marked by excitement when he made a remarkable 63-yard punt return during his very first preseason game against the Dallas Cowboys. However, his promising career took a devastating turn the following season when he suffered injuries to both his an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) and medial collateral ligament (MCL), effectively derailing his professional aspirations. Despite his efforts to recover, he was waived by the Bengals and subsequently signed by the Buccaneers, only to be released two weeks later as final roster cuts approached. He briefly joined the Jacksonville Jaguars in 2012, appearing in six games before being released in September 2013.

Although his NFL journey didn’t unfold as spectacularly as he might have hoped, Shipley is fondly remembered in the college football realm for his exceptional performance with the Texas Longhorns. Between 2004 and 2009, he played under coach Mack Brown, establishing himself as a standout player. In October 2008, he set a record for receptions at Texas, catching 15 passes for a staggering 168 yards in a game against Oklahoma State. Over his collegiate career, he participated in 53 games, earning All-American honors in 2009, the same year the Longhorns clinched the Big 12 title and advanced to the national championship game. Notably, Shipley achieved back-to-back 1,000-yard receiving seasons during the 2008 and 2009 seasons, solidifying his place in Texas football history.
